作者tomex (tomex)
看板C_Sharp
标题Re: [心得] 命名惯例
时间Tue Feb 10 14:00:00 2004
※ 引述《tomex (tomex)》之铭言:
: .net及java各有所长及风格,不过我觉得java说明比较完整且详细
我发现唯一.Net与java命名相同的原则就是:
只要是变数或instance,就使用camel命名(commandTest)
而不用Pascal命名法(CommandTest)
而且它们都舍弃匈牙利命名法(就是把型别带入命名, cmdTest)
理由是compiler自然知道它们的型别!
不过带有type的变数名,对programmer撰写code时有帮助
我个人是建议封闭性或区域性的变数可带有type的匈牙利命名法!
因为还是要顺从每个人的不同处,硬是强硬规定
根本是无意义的事,只要不影响大局,要尊重少数...
--
You're recommended to vist C_Sharp in PTT.
We are the C#, resistance is futile.
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 140.119.183.211